  1. Our chi weenie is 10 months old and has been very difficult to Housebreak, it’s always been with peeing she never poops in the house. I feel like I’ve read every blog about it! We have followed all the rules, she is crated and doesn’t go in her crate, she is kept on a feeding and drinking schedule, rewarded when potties outside. The bell has finally helped and she knows to ring it and goes out to pee. The problem now is getting her to the next step. When we have tried to leave her in a room when we leave for a short time she will not hold it and will pee. We take the bell away when we have tried this so she doesn’t get confused and ring it. So how do we get her past this so she can have more freedom from her crate and be trusted to not go in the house, I was hoping to be further along with this by now it can be frustrating to have 10 months of cleaning up urine all the time.
